> <DIV>What, exactly, is this mysterious inconvenience these
> forums pose over e-mail?

Well for one, if you got a foggy idea you want to throw out to see what 
people think, and it turns out to be pretty stupid after you've had a 
chance to think about it, a list serve will make it a brief blip on 
folk's radar, with a forum, the lame things you think up and post at 3 in 
the morning are on public display for months on end.

A list serve also just seems more dynamic, you do get a lot of "Me too" 
messages but you also get a lot of people chiming in feedback they would 
never bother with posting on a forum, and when you do throw out a few 
ideas and get a few "cool stuff" comments, you get the encouragement to 
keep posting new idea for general viewing.
Also with a forum you have to decide to go and look at deadlands stuff, 
with a mailing list it there when you check your mail, all new stuff, 
with titles, and deletetable if your ain't interested at the moment.

Then thier's trying the rigaramoll of getting another username and 
password approved and then trying to remember what they are, not a major 
task, but when you look in a forum for the first time and see something 
you want to post on, its just annoying to have to go through a buracratic 
process to be allowed to post.
